open-quantum-safe / oqs-provider

OpenSSL 3 provider containing post-quantum algorithms
https://openquantumsafe.org
MIT License
200 stars 83 forks source link

Move off CircleCI #248

Open baentsch opened 1 year ago

baentsch commented 1 year ago

Streamline use of CI environments: Github CI seems to permit running on at least as many platforms as CircleCI and doesn't seem to "run out of credits" for an OpenSource project as CCI does sometimes.

Any thoughts speaking against this solicited.

baentsch commented 1 year ago

Github does not support native runners other then x64, so things like https://github.com/open-quantum-safe/oqs-provider/issues/94#issuecomment-1712405056 are impossible (within reasonable execution time, i.e., not using qemu) are not possible on Github CI (short of deploying self-hosted runners).